I want to have children… they reassured me that I’d still be able to have children, I’d just have to try a bit harder.” An ectopic pregnancy affects 1 in 80 pregnancies. It means a pregnancy which implants outside the uterus. The majority of ectopic pregnancies happen in the fallopian tube but they can also occur in the ovaries, cervix or abdomen.
